Inputs and Outputs
The input and output selections that are offered is an important factor when comparing two amplifiers. Here you can find how the I/O selections of the Cambridge Audio Evo 75 and NAD C 399 BluOS-D differs from each other.
Cambridge Audio Evo 75 Inputs
- Total Number of Analog Inputs: 1
- 1 Optical Digital Input
- 1 Coaxial Digital Input
- USB Input:
- USB-A(music playback from a USB flash memory device or portable hard drive)
- HDMI ARC
- Ethernet Port
NAD C 399 BluOS-D Inputs
- Total Number of Analog Inputs: 2
- Phono Input
- 2 Optical Digital Input
- 2 Coaxial Digital Input
- USB Input:
- USB-A(Service Only)
- USB-A(Thumbdrive/External HD)
- USB-B(Service Only0
- HDMI eARC
- Ethernet Port

What's in the Box of Cambridge Audio Evo 75?
Here are the items that are included inside the box of Evo 75:
- Integrated amplifier
- 6-feet AC power cord
- Remote control (EVO)
- 2 AAA batteries
- 4 Side-panels (2 pre-installed)
- Quick Setup Guide
- Important Safety Instructions
What's in the Box of NAD C 399 BluOS-D?
Here are the items that come with the C 399 BluOS-D:
- Integrated amplifier
- 6-feet AC power cord
- Remote control (SR 9)
- 2 AA batteries
- 3 Antennas
- Auto calibration microphone
- USB microphone adapter
- Quick Setup Guide
- Internet Update Guidlines
- Important Safety Instructions
- Dirac Live Quickstart Guide
- Warranty Card
